Free Introductory Outdoor Skills Event for Women

Raleigh, N.C.
Aug 10, 2026

The N.C. Wildlife Resources Commission (NCWRC) is holding a free hands-on engaging introduction to the Outdoor Skills Academy for Women event on Saturday, August 22, 2026, at the Alamance County Wildlife Club in Graham.

“By sampling a range of outdoor skills at this event, participants can begin building confidence, fostering connections and deepening their commitment to conservation,” said Western Engagement & Education Supervisor Casey Williams. “When women are able to explore these activities hands-on, they don’t just gain knowledge—they uncover new passions and become empowered stewards of North Carolina’s wild spaces."

This event runs from 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. Pre-registration is required and participants must be at least 16 years old. No prior experience is required for any of the four sessions, which include: 

  • Introduction to Shotgun
  • Fly Fishing Basics
  • Hunting, Regulations & Tree Stands
  • Wild Habitats
    • Native plant restoration
    • Invasive species control
    • Creating environments for local wildlife
    • Sustainable land use practices


All materials and equipment will be provided unless otherwise noted.
